So was noticing on my Garmin 530 - all the reported s/w revisions: Main SW 4.00 GPS SW 3.01 COM SW 6.00 VLOC SW 3.01 G/S SW 2.03 LAND DB World 1.01 How does one update this software? Any idea where to find out what the latest released versions are from Garmin? It doesn't show up at http://www.garmin.com/support/blosp.jsp Is this something I shouldn't even worry about? Searched the net without luck. I guess the PC world has trained me to always be watching the revisions of the code I'm running. Any help appreciated...... |

Interesting question... The software for the Garmin 430/530 is located in hardware, i.e. in ROM inside the GPS. Software updates are rare and if they were to occur they would be announced via an airworthiness directive or service bulletin and the upgrade would not be something an owner could perform himself. |
